DMA facility is presently permitted by SEBI only to institutional purchasers and further extended to funding managers. Such institutional shoppers might use the services of an funding manager or advisor or portfolio supervisor (“Investment Manager”) to avail the DMA facility, as mentioned in the SEBI circular. Before extending the SA facility, broker-dealers should enter into agreements with buyers and undertake due diligence. Stock exchanges are liable for verifying the presence of the agreement between the broker-dealer and the shopper before approving the SA facility. Direct Market Access (DMA) is a facility which allows Members to offer their purchasers direct access to the trade trading system via their Computer to Computer Link (CTCL) infrastructure without guide intervention by them.

However, to ensure threat administration and mitigation, orders routed via clients’ trading functions via SA must cross via the pre-trade risk-management layer offered by the stock change. Parameters for these risk- administration controls are decided and configured by the broker-dealer registered with IFSCA and authorised to offer SA services.

While DMA enables traders to directly entry inventory exchange buying and selling systems, they’re nonetheless certain to using the stockbroker’s trading system. This arrangement raises issues as stockbrokers can potentially acquire entry to confidential and proprietary buying and selling strategies employed by investors. Stockbrokers themselves must implement sure checks before providing DMA facilities to their purchasers. They have to set trading limits, exposure limits, and place limits for all DMA shoppers primarily based on danger evaluation, credit score high quality, and available margins. Compliance Officer overseeing compliance or risk-management functions, such because the Chief Risk Officer or Chief Compliance Officer, are responsible for setting these limits.
